BackSituated in Burbank, Illinois, Vegetable Juices, Inc. operates not as a storefront for casual consumers, but as a significant industrial backbone for the food and beverage industry. This facility is a crucial link in the supply chain, specializing in producing and distributing natural vegetable ingredients. It is from facilities like this that the core components of many widely available consumer products, including healthy drinks and prepared meals, originate. The business model is strictly business-to-business (B2B), focusing on supplying large-scale food manufacturers rather than serving individuals seeking a single fresh juice. Its client roster includes major global food and beverage corporations, underscoring its role as a key player in the ingredients market.
A Hub of Production and Innovation
For decades, Vegetable Juices, Inc. has established itself as a producer of high-quality vegetable-based ingredients. Their offerings are diverse, moving beyond simple juices to include a wide array of products such as organic juice concentrates, purees, and diced or chopped vegetables. This versatility allows them to serve various segments of the food industry, providing essential materials for everything from smoothies and sauces to ready-to-eat meals. The company has been noted for its innovation, particularly through its proprietary Advanced Concentration Technology® (ACT). This process is designed to be gentler on the raw ingredients, helping to preserve the natural vitamins, minerals, and volatile flavor compounds that are often lost in more aggressive processing methods. The goal of this technology is to deliver a product that retains the authentic taste and nutritional value of fresh produce, a critical factor for brands that market their products as natural and healthy.
The company offers a variety of popular concentrates like sweet potato, celery, and cucumber, and also develops custom blends to meet the specific needs of their clients. This capability for customization is a significant advantage, allowing food manufacturers to create unique flavor profiles for their products. By focusing on being a premier vegetable juice supplier, they provide the foundational elements that other companies use to build their brands, whether it's for a new line of cold-pressed juice or a savory soup base.
Operational Efficiency: The View from the Loading Dock
For a B2B supplier, logistical efficiency is just as important as product quality. The feedback from the transport professionals who interact with the facility daily provides a clear picture of its operational strengths and weaknesses. The overwhelming consensus points toward a highly efficient and well-managed system for loading and unloading. Multiple reviews from truck drivers highlight the speed of the service, with some describing it as the "fastest place to be unloaded." Turnaround times are frequently mentioned as being impressively short, with one driver noting they were in and out within 45 minutes. The staff is consistently praised for being professional, great to work with, and maintaining a positive attitude, which contributes significantly to a smooth and pleasant experience for drivers who are often on tight schedules.
Further enhancing its reputation among logistics partners are several driver-friendly policies and amenities. The facility is known to accommodate early arrivals, offering a degree of flexibility that is highly valued in the trucking industry. The availability of a bathroom for drivers is another small but significant detail that demonstrates respect for their partners. For those needing to wait for their scheduled appointment, overnight parking is reportedly possible on a nearby dead-end road. This entire ecosystem of efficiency and consideration suggests that Vegetable Juices, Inc. understands that a reliable supply chain depends on strong relationships with its logistics providers.
Navigating the Challenges: What Partners Should Know
Despite the high marks for speed and professionalism, the facility does present some physical challenges. A recurring point of feedback is that the space for maneuvering trucks is limited, with docks that are described as "a little tricky and tight." This requires a higher level of skill from drivers when backing into a bay and is an important piece of information for any new logistics company planning a pickup or delivery. While not a deal-breaker, it is a practical constraint that requires planning and experienced drivers to navigate safely and efficiently.
Furthermore, an older review from several years ago pointed to a rigid appointment-only system and a significant delay caused by a warehouse system change. While more recent reviews suggest that efficiency is now the norm, this past issue serves as a reminder of the importance of clear communication and appointment confirmation. Like many industrial food processors, the environment has a distinct character; one driver noted the powerful smell of garlic during a pickup, a testament to the raw, potent ingredients being handled on-site. The facility's operational hours, running 24 hours a day from Monday to Friday but closed on weekends, also require careful scheduling from its partners.
Corporate Strength and Market Position
With roots going back over 80 years, Vegetable Juices, Inc. has a long and established history in the Chicago area, a traditional hub for the American food industry. A pivotal moment in its recent history came in 2014 when it was acquired by Naturex, a French-based global leader in specialty plant-based ingredients. This acquisition was a strategic move that effectively doubled Naturex's food and beverage operations in the United States, integrating a well-respected American company into a larger international network. This corporate backing provides Vegetable Juices, Inc. with enhanced resources, global reach, and stability, reinforcing its position as a reliable supplier for major multinational food companies.
